For the past eight years, shaving my head for St. Baldrick’s has become far more than a yearly tradition — it’s a commitment shaped by the incredible support I’ve received from family, friends, coworkers, and my community. Every year, people have stepped forward with encouragement, donations, and stories of their own connections to childhood cancer. Their support has turned a simple act of shaving into something powerful: a reminder that none of us fight alone.


Because of that support, I’ve been able to help raise funds that fuel research, give families hope, and honor the kids who inspire this mission. Each year’s shave represents hundreds of conversations, shared memories, and renewed determination. The impact isn’t just in the dollars raised — it’s in the collective strength of everyone who has stood beside me, year after year, believing that we can make a difference.


Eight years in, I’m proud of what we’ve accomplished together. And I’m even more grateful for the people who have made it possible. Their generosity and encouragement continue to push me forward, reminding me why this cause matters and why I’ll keep showing up.
